What is Nafs?
The nafs — or baser self — is the veil between Allah and His slave. As long as this veil remains, the seeker cannot attain the vision of Allah. When the nafs is purified and elevated to the level of nafs-e-mutmaina (the satisfied self), the heart becomes Qalb-e-Saleem — pure and flawless — and the path to Divine closeness opens wide.
The book explains that the nafs is not a simple enemy. It is cunning, hidden and deeply rooted. Its desires begin with the stomach, expand into sexual desire, then grow into the love of wealth, power and fame. From these root desires spring fifteen devastating spiritual diseases — arrogance, pride, jealousy, narcissism, pretence, anger, malice, stinginess, backbiting, lying, evil speculation, snooping, talebearing, negligence and greed.
The Spiritual Diseases Destroying Us
Each of these diseases is a veil between man and Allah. Arrogance destroyed Satan despite fifty thousand years of worship. Jealousy caused the first murder on earth. Pretence is described as closer to idolatry than faith. Backbiting devours good deeds like fire burns wood. Negligence keeps the seeker frozen on his spiritual journey.
Most alarmingly, these diseases operate in secret. A person may perform prayers, fasting and worship outwardly, yet be completely destroyed inwardly by these illnesses without even realising it. As Sultan Bahoo (R.A.) warns — even if a person’s back bends from excessive devotions, these diseases cannot be cured by hard worship alone.
